Summary
The study of the human genome laid the foundations for the search for a large number of molecular alterations related to different diseases. The Precision medicine allows us to know molecular alterations that can be detected and targeted for therapeutic purposes. There is little data in Argentina about the incidence and frequencies of alterations molecules associated with the most frequent tumors. Through the selection of a gene panel, analysis of the genetic information obtained analysis allows classifying tumors from a point of view therapeutic. On the other hand, through the same panel, markers of resistance to drugs that allow the incorporation of retreatment therapies. Together with the proposed panel, the ancestry of the patients will be evaluated to determine whether the frequencies of molecular alterations vary between the different ethnic origins of the country.
Trial Details
NCT Number NCT06995235
Lead Sponsor Hospital Italiano de Buenos Aires
Conditions Neoplasms Malignant, Biomarkers
Enrollment 100 participants
Start Date 2024-04-01
Primary Completion 2025-12 (estimated)
Study Completion 2026-04-22 (estimated)
